Batch-level Activity Cost
Costs associated with activities that are related to a batch of products rather than each individual unit, such as the cost of setting up machinery for each batch.
Departmental Overhead Rates
The method for allocating overhead costs to specific departments based on departmental activities and cost drivers.
Activity-based Costing
A costing method that identifies the activities that a firm performs and then assigns indirect costs to products based on each product's use of those activities.
Activity Cost Pools
Groupings of individual costs related to a particular activity, used in activity-based costing to allocate costs more accurately.
